Why Jacoby Brissett's Start At QB Matters


Not only are the Patriots 3-0 in Tom Brady's absence but they've also done the unthinkable and not by choice but out of necessity... They started an African-American quarterback Jacoby Brissett.

In franchise history the Patriots prior to tonight the team had only dressed six black quarterbacks Onree Jackson (who never played in a game), Condredge Holloway (who never played a game), Eddie McAshan (who never played a game), Michael Bishop (whose only game was in relief in 2000), Rohan Davey (the 2004 MVP of NFL Europe), and Jay Walker (who also never played).
